
Menbud usulkan tiap provinsi miliki ahli untuk petakan cagar budaya
Menbud, or the Minister of Culture and Education in Indonesia, has recently proposed a new initiative to preserve and protect the country’s cultural heritage. The proposal suggests that each province in Indonesia should have experts dedicated to mapping out and documenting the country’s cultural heritage sites.
This initiative comes in response to the growing concern over the loss of Indonesia’s cultural heritage. Many historical sites, traditional practices, and cultural artifacts are at risk of being lost or destroyed due to various factors such as urbanization, development, and neglect.
By having experts in each province dedicated to mapping out and documenting cultural heritage sites, the government hopes to create a comprehensive database of Indonesia’s cultural heritage. This database would not only help in preserving and protecting these sites but also in promoting them as tourist attractions and sources of national pride.
The experts tasked with this mapping and documentation would be responsible for identifying and recording cultural heritage sites in their respective provinces. They would also work with local communities to raise awareness about the importance of preserving these sites and to develop strategies for their conservation.
In addition, the experts would also work with relevant government agencies and stakeholders to ensure that cultural heritage sites are properly managed and protected. This could involve implementing conservation measures, conducting research and documentation, and developing sustainable tourism practices.
